Appendix D: Indicators
D.2 Training Indicator
The system can calculate and print a training indicator when ergometry is complete. These
training indicators are reflective of the entire circulation response to the performance invoked
by ergometry. This value however only has relevance when it is compared to values from
multiple ergometry sessions of the patient over a period of time. These values are very good
indicators of the patient’s training progress.
The training indicator is calculated by the computer as follows:
training indicator = S - D * HR * M
P
S = maximum systole
D = maximum diastole
HR = maximum heart rate
M = patient’s weight
P = maximum resulting performance
$
The training indicator serves to compare multiple ergometric sessions of
a single patient. This value is not applicable for the comparison of different
patients. Basically, a drop in the value on a patient’s chronologically con-
secutive ergometric sessions is a positive indication of good training
progress.
